Output 05babd52638f2c64e510a9adc238bf38fbc82b1997cebbdbaf60cc160c888eec:1

value
915237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 343bec325cee84b4c8422cba3d3b47084fb18f99 OP_EQUAL
address
36TCr1x6iVTYprCdFm5JzrjzKqHdoHXcg7
transaction
05babd52638f2c64e510a9adc238bf38fbc82b1997cebbdbaf60cc160c888eec
confirmations
416048
spent
true